A government agency provides labour data as presented in the table below. Based on this data, answer the following questions.

Answer #1

Population = 50400

Labor force = Employed + Unemployed

Employed = 16650

Unemployed = 4000

Hence, the labor force = 16650 + 4000 = 20650

Unemployment rate = Unemployed/Labor force = 4000/20650 = 19.37%

Employment rate = Employed/Labor force = 16650/20650 = 80.63%

Participation rate = Labor force/Population of 15 years and over = 20650/50400 = 40.97%
